Texas Gov. Greg Abbott (R) has called for a criminal investigation by the state’s attorney general, secretary of state and Texas Rangers into “widespread problems” and “allegations of improprieties” in Harris County’s election.

Harris County has 782 polling places spread across about 1,700 square miles, a space larger than Rhode Island. On Election Day, each polling place is run by a presiding judge — either the elected precinct chair, their designee or a county designee — from one party and a deputy from the other, assisted by clerks and other workers. Presiding judges earn $20 an hour, the rest $17 an hour. The county also had more than 160 technicians available to help with voting machines and other problems.

“It was clear to me that we were going to run out by afternoon,” he said, so he called the election office, and “they reassured me that we were going to have more sent out.” At a polling place in Houston’s Heights neighborhood, where election results were almost evenly divided between the two parties, presiding judge Jennifer Kruse opened with just four of 20 voting machines working. When those four machines failed within 20 minutes, Kruse said, she had to turn a line of people away.
